英英释义
testimonial[ ,testi'məuniəl ]
n.
something that serves as evidence
同义词:testimony
something given or done as an expression of esteem
同义词:tribute
something that recommends (or expresses commendation) of a person or thing as worthy or desirable
同义词:recommendationgood word
adj.
expressing admiration or appreciation
"testimonial dinner"
of or relating to or constituting testimony

testimonial (adj.)
early 15c., "of or pertaining to testimony," in part from testimonial (n.) and from Late Latin testimonialis, from Latin testimonium (see testimony). Originally especially in phrase letters testimonial (Middle French lettres testimoniaulx, Latin litteræ testimoniales) "document or documents attesting to a fact or to the good standing of the bearer," literally "letters serving for evidence."
testimonial (n.)
"statement, declaration," also "writing testifying to one's qualification or character," early 15c. (from Old French testimonial, variant of tesmoignal), short for letters testimonial (see testimonial (adj.)). Meaning "gift presented as an expression of appreciation" is from 1838.
